Overview Of Venous Treatments
When it comes to dealing with varicose veins, spider veins and, other vein conditions, the process is relatively straightforward. Dr. Amanda Lloyd walks you through what the expect from vein treatments, options available, and results.
Video Transcript
What are the types of abnormal veins?
There are 3 types of abnormal veins. Varicose veins are the largest, and are bulging and ropy. The reticular veins are medium, sized and bluish color, and these spider veins are the smallest in size and are purple color.
What happens during a consultation?
During your consultation at the Skin & Vein Institute, you will have an ultrasound done which will create a roadmap so that we know where and what type of abnormal veins you have and can then determine what treatments are going to be the most effective to restore normal circulation to your lower legs.
What are the treatment options?
These abnormal veins each have their own type of treatment. For the large abnormal veins we use something called endovenous laser ablation, where the laser goes inside the vein, heats the inside of the wall of the vein and makes it sticky so that the vein adheres to itself and your body can take it away.
For the tortuous veins and the reticular veins, endovenous chemical ablation is used. Where a sclerosing solution is injected into the vein, causing the chemical reaction, to make the vein wall sticky so they stick together and your body naturally takes away the vein. The small spider veins are treated with Sclerotherapy where a similar sclerosing solution is injected into the vein making the vein wall sticky so your body can take away these abnormal veins.
What is the treatment downtime?
Endovenous laser ablation, endovenous chemical ablation and Sclerotherapy all have little to no downtime. In fact after endovenous laser ablation you need to walk for an hour.
What needs to be done after the treatment?
It is very important after each procedure that you wear your compression stockings so that you receive the maximum results.
What are the limitations after the vein treatment?
There are very few limitations after your vein treatment. It is recommended that you do not fly for 2 weeks after the treatment. It is also recommended that you don’t increase your abdominal pressure by doing something like sit ups for 2 weeks after the treatment.
Are vein treatments safe and effective?
These 3 veins treatments are both safe and effective at restoring the normal circulation in your lower extremities without surgery. Additionally the appearance to your legs is improved and they feel healthy and vibrant so that you can return to your normal active lifestyle.
